Faegre Drinker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Faegre Drinker in the United States is $57.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$118,317. Salaries at Faegre Drinker typically range from $50 to $65 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Minneapolis?

Understanding the cost of living near Minneapolis is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Faegre Drinker.
Minneapolis'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.8 (4.8% more expensive than US average; 7.9% more than MN average). Major city, vibrant, housing costs above US avg, cold winters (high heating). Metro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Faegre Drinker,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,100+ A significant portion of Faegre Drinker sal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$230 (Heating significant)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$120 (Metro Transit mon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,920 - $4,480+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
